16(1)A person who is, by virtue of any provision of this Schedule, given an opportunity to make representations must have the opportunity to make representations in relation to all of the information on which [F1DBS] intends to rely in taking a decision under this Schedule.E+W
(2)Any requirement of this Schedule to give a person an opportunity to make representations does not apply if [F1DBS] does not know and cannot reasonably ascertain the whereabouts of the person.
(3)The opportunity to make representations does not include the opportunity to make representations that findings of fact made by a competent body were wrongly made.
(4)Findings of fact made by a competent body are findings of fact made in proceedings before [F2the Secretary of State in the exercise of the Secretary of State's functions under section 141B of the Education Act 2002, or in proceedings before] one of the following bodies or any of its committees—
F3(a).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
(b)the General Teaching Council for Wales;
(c)the Council of the Pharmaceutical Society of Great Britain;
(d)the General Medical Council;
(e)the General Dental Council;
(f)the General Optical Council;
(g)the General Osteopathic Council;
(h)the General Chiropractic Council;
(i)the Nursing and Midwifery Council;
(j)[F4the Health and Care Professions Council];
(k)the General Social Care Council;
[F5(l) Social Care Wales]
[F6(m)Social Work England.]
[F7(4A)The reference in sub-paragraph (4) to “any of its committees” is, in respect of Social Care Wales, to be read as if it were a reference to “any panel established under Part 8 of the Regulation and Inspection of Social Care (Wales) Act 2016”.]
(5)The Secretary of State may by order amend sub-paragraph (4) by inserting a paragraph or amending or omitting a paragraph for the time being contained in the sub-paragraph.

17(1)This paragraph applies to a person who is included in a barred list (except a person included in pursuance of paragraph 1 or 7) if, before he was included in the list, [F1DBS] was unable to ascertain his whereabouts.E+W
(2)This paragraph also applies to such a person if—
(a)he did not, before the end of any time prescribed for the purpose, make representations as to why he should not be included in the list, and
(b)[F1DBS] grants him permission to make such representations out of time.
(3)If a person to whom this paragraph applies makes such representations after the prescribed time—
(a)[F1DBS] must consider the representations, and
(b)if it thinks that it is not appropriate for the person to be included in the list concerned, it must remove him from the list.
(4)For the purposes of this paragraph, it is immaterial that any representations mentioned in sub-paragraph (3) relate to a time after the person was included in the list concerned.
